The Presidency Internship Programme 2014/2015

The Presidency Internship Programme 2014/2015
Closing Date: 6 December 2013 at 16:30
Location: Pretoria
Remuneration: Interns will receive a stipend of R4 000 per month
Duration: 1 April 2014 to 31 March 2015 (12 months)
The Presidency is offering internship opportunities to provide South African graduates and undergraduates with the opportunity to gain workplace experience in the field of work that they have studied.
Requirements:
Applicants must be graduates in any of the fields listed above, or undergraduate students where an internship is a prerequisite to obtain their formal qualification. Applications must be submitted on a Z83 Form, obtainable from any Public Service department, stating the field being applied for (choose from the above list), a CV together with certified copies of certificates, transcripts, a letter from the institution for the undergraduates and an Identity Document. Failure to submit the required documents will result in the application not being considered. A pre-employment security screening will be conducted on candidates relating to RSA citizenship, criminal record, credit record and verification of qualification. The outcome of this screening will determine suitability for employment.
